Description Gregor Mi 2018-12-03 20:45:01 UTC
From time to time it happens to me that I accidentally hit Ctrl+Shift+R instead of +T. So, instead of creating a new tab, I destroy the current one which is bad for the workflow :-).

Suggestion: Use another default shortcut to close the active tab.
